ASHLAND, Mo. – The William Woods University Baseball team dropped the series finale with RV Missouri Baptist on Saturday afternoon, 14-5. The loss drops the Owls to 5-12-1 on the season and leaves them searching for their first conference win.
The Owls travel to Harris-Stowe State University for a three-game conference series in St. Louis starting on Thursday, March 7. The Owls face the Hornets in a doubleheader on Thursday starting at 12 p.m. with the third game held on Friday, March 8, at 3 p.m.
Game Flow
MBU opened up the scoring in the top of the first with an RBI single and a two RBI double. They added four more in the top of the third with two coming from a two-run home run to take a 7-0 lead.
In the bottom of the third,
Trevor Garriott and
Alex Wimer scored on
Quincy Jones' single after both being walked.
MBU matched the Owls two runs in the bottom of the inning with two RBI singles to give them a 9-2 lead. They added one more in the top of the sixth.
In the bottom of the sixth, the Owls put up three runs on four hits.
Jake Fleming reached base on a fielder's choice and was moved to second on a ground out.
Chase Gibson's single moved Fleming to third, and Garriott's single just over third base brought him home. Garriott and
Tristan Steffens, pinch runner for
Chase Gibson, crossed home plate on
Douglas Martin's RBI single to left-center field. With
Jordan Smith's walk, bases were loaded with two outs. MBU made a pitching change, and the final out came on the next pitch.
MBU added four more runs in the seventh and eighth while holding the Owls from scoring again, ending the game with a 14-5 loss.
The Owls recorded seven hits coming from seven different players.
Douglas Martin and
Quincy Jones recorded two RBI each.
Travis Hennessey (1-2) was credited with the loss. He struck out four.
